Summary
MAIN D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ES 1. To provide administrative and practical support to the Outreach and Education Team to assist with the effective delivery of health promotion, education and outreach activities. 2. To support the management and organisation of outreach and health promotion resources, including maintaining stock levels, undertaking regular stock checks and supporting stock audits. 3. To support with stock requisitions, ensuring requests are accurately recorded and processed in a timely manner, and that appropriate levels of resources are available for planned activities and events. 4. To support the team with general administration tasks, including data collection, data entry, maintaining records and preparing information for monitoring and reporting purposes. 5. To support the administration and coordination of training sessions and events, including using platforms such as Eventbrite to upload training opportunities, maintain event information and support participant bookings where required. 6. To support the preparation and organisation of outreach events, including ensuring appropriate resources, promotional materials and equipment are available and ready for delivery. 7. To provide practical support at outreach events and health promotion activities, working alongside members of the team and partner organisations to ensure activities run effectively. 8. To assist with the distribution and organisation of health promotion resources and materials, ensuring resources are appropriately stored, recorded and available for use. 9. To maintain accurate records relating to stock, events, training, outreach activity and other administrative functions, in accordance with relevant information governance and service procedures. 10. To support the team with the collection and collation of monitoring information relating to outreach and health promotion interventions, contributing to service reports as required. 11. To establish and maintain effective working relationships with members of the Outreach and Education Team and relevant partner agencies, providing a professional and helpful point of contact where appropriate. 12. To support the organisation and promotion of health promotion campaigns, events and activities, including World AIDS Day, National HIV Testing Week, Sexual Health Week, LGBT+ History Month, Pride, Black History Month and other relevant promotions and events. 13. To support the team with the coordination and preparation of materials for professional training, community education sessions and other health promotion activities. 14. To assist with maintaining calendars, event schedules, meeting minutes and actions and other administrative systems to support the effective planning and coordination of team activities. 15. To ensure that all administrative and support activities are undertaken in accordance with relevant organisational policies and procedures, including information governance, confidentiality, safeguarding and health and safety requirements. 16. To manage own workload effectively, prioritising tasks according to service requirements and communicating with the line manager regarding workload, deadlines and any issues that may affect delivery. 17. To work flexibly to meet the developing needs of the service and its service users across a wide geographical area. This may include supporting outreach events during evenings and weekends where required.
